Liability to Customers and the Public Print

Third-party exposure.

WHEN THIS ARISES

Someone is injured on your premises Your work causes damage or injury A product you sold causes harm Your advice or service causes financial loss

WHAT COVER TYPICALLY ADDRESSES

Public liability, for injury and damage Professional indemnity, for financial loss from professional services Product-related cover, for goods

WHAT TO ESTABLISH

Which applies to your activity Whether customers require evidence of it

WHAT REDUCES THE RISK

Safe premises Competent work Clear instructions and warnings with products Written scope, so obligations are bounded

THE SCOPE POINT

Vague obligations produce claims about things you did not agree to do.

WHAT TO DOCUMENT

What you did, and to what standard Any instructions or warnings given Any issue you raised with the customer

WHAT TO DO IF SOMETHING HAPPENS

Record everything immediately Notify your insurer promptly Do not admit liability before advice

THAT LAST POINT

Policies frequently require it.
